The Berlin wall
This photography series was created during my third year at UCA Rochester as part of a project in collaboration with a client. The images were shot in conjunction with the Royal Engineers Museum in Gillingham.
In this series, I photographed a model named Eleanor in front of a section of the Berlin Wall. The portraits feature Eleanor dressed in fashion inspired by the 1980s, the decade when the wall came down. Additionally, the series includes close-up, black-and-white shots of the wall that is part of the museum's collection.
